Intrusive igneous rocks cool slowlybecause they form underground. Because they cool slowly, intrusive igneous rocks have large, sometimes interlocking, crystals that you can see. Which of the following is NOT an intrusive igneous rock?

Gabbro

Diorite

Granite

Basalt
